尽管你的 iPhone 拥有20世纪90年代后期超级计算机般的数字运算能力,但很多软件的日常任务似乎仍需要花很多时...[作者空间]
在 Web 和移动应用程序中有很多情况要求用户上传图像。它以各种方式完成,但这里有一些以图像形式获取用户输入的原则...[作者空间]
这是证明“简单即是最佳”的另一个例子。在许多货币输入的情形(例如发送银行付款或添加提示时)要求用户输入一个金额值,...[作者空间]
邮政编码在世界各地各不相同。不要试图猜测用户的格式:只需给他们一个文本输入字段,让他们自己填写。如果需要验证编码,...[作者空间]
许多网站和应用程序的最终目标是让用户付费。这是值得庆祝的事情:我们做了一些有用的事情或提供了一些非常好的东西,以至...[作者空间]
应该给输入完整日期(如出生日期)的用户提供日期和月份的下拉菜单,然后年份数字可以手动输入。日期和月份足够短,用下拉...[作者空间]
电话号码的输入应尽可能的轻松,不要试图验证它们,不要将它们分成组,不要用括号包起来,不要用你在网络上看到的任何其他...[作者空间]
UI设计人员有广泛的控件和UI元素可供挑选,但令人惊奇的是,我们总是非常频繁地看到表单里选用了很难用的控件。 通过...[作者空间]
填写表单时更优的用户体验,总体原则可以概括为“宽容”。 用户所做的事情往往看起来很奇怪,不可预测,但他们可能有很好...[作者空间]
如果你真的必须在服务器端验证而不能在客户端进行验证(参见#45),那么永远不要将用户发送回表单却不告诉他们下一步该...[作者空间]
表单上的验证是指,当用户辛苦输入的一些信息存在问题时,给他们的视觉反馈。当用户移动到下一个字段时,你就知道用户已完...[作者空间]
几乎所有类型的软件产品都有一个表单(一个页面,其中包含用户必须填写的文本,数字和其他数据的输入),它们通常是令人非...[作者空间]
默认情况下,许多系统都不区分大小写,但你可能没有注意到它过。因为它就应该是如此,并且运转得非常好。例如,发送电子邮...[作者空间]
如果用户尝试登录并失败,可以肯定他们下一步操作是点击“忘记密码”。不要让他们再次输入电子邮件,用他们之前登录的条目...[作者空间]
由于浏览器和移动设备制造商使用了更一致的日期选择器 UI ,这个问题不像以前那么明显。通过触发设备原生的日期选择器...[作者空间]
只有精神病患者会故意让他们的UI移动,迫使用户在尝试点按或点击控件之后猜测会发生什么。 20世纪90年代末到21世...[作者空间]
表格需要尽可能减少与用户之间的摩擦,因为填表是一个巨大的操作障碍,转换率很低,因此要让用户尽可能轻松地完成。 有时...[作者空间]
你的用户经常是长期苦苦挣扎在小小的手机屏幕上,通过屏幕键盘小心翼翼地填完了你需要的表单。所以,除非用户明确放弃流程...[作者空间]
你的用户输入了一个电子邮件地址,而你正在考虑编写一些代码来验证它(检查它是否采用合理的格式,并且没有输入乱码或错误...[作者空间]
很难理解这种禁用粘贴的模式从哪里来,或者禁用粘贴能解决什么安全问题。使用页面上的 JavaScript 来防止用户...[作者空间]